Shoe airing device for operating room
By introducing a drying box, rack, collection tray, blackout curtain, and warm air blower into the operating room shoe drying device, the problems of liquid contamination and disinfection were solved, achieving efficient drying and sterilization of slippers and ensuring safe storage of slippers.

[0001] The utility model relates to the technical field of sanitary tools, and more specifically, to a shoe drying device for operating rooms. Background Technique
[0002] The shoe drying rack for operating rooms is a special sanitary equipment designed for medical staff. It is usually made of stainless steel or antibacterial plastic, with the characteristics of corrosion resistance and easy disinfection. Through a multi-layer hollow structure, it accelerates the water drainage and drying of the soles of shoes, reducing the growth of bacteria. For example, the shoe drying rack for interventional operating rooms with the patent number CN207492375U includes a main frame and universal wheels. The characteristics are that a tray is provided at the bottom of the main frame, and push-pull frames are designed in a layered manner in the vertical direction inside the main frame. A push-pull armrest is installed in the front of the push-pull frame, and horizontal grid bars for placing shoes are evenly distributed inside the push-pull frame. On both sides inside the main frame, there are tray rails with a "匚" - shaped cross-section, and each push-pull frame is slidably installed with a clearance fit between the corresponding two tray rails.
[0003] In the prior art, the device only considers the placement requirements for slippers and does not consider the disinfection requirements of the operating room. Moreover, with an open rack, it is inevitable that there will be splashing and dripping of liquids, resulting in the contamination of shoes. Content of the Utility Model

[0033] Specifically, when storing and drying slippers, place the slippers on the rack 2 and turn on the heater 6 and ultraviolet germicidal lamp 4 to dry and disinfect the slippers. The residual liquid on the slippers drips into the collection tray 3, preventing the liquid from splashing elsewhere. Compared with open shoe racks, it has a better sterilization and drying ability and prevents the slippers from being contaminated during storage.

[0037] Specifically, by setting up the electric push rod 23, when it is necessary to take out the slippers, the push rod can slowly push out the bracket 2, making it easier to take them out.
[0038] The absorbent cotton 32 is designed to absorb liquid dripping from slippers in a timely manner, reducing the humidity inside the drying chamber 1 and preventing excessive humidity from causing bacterial growth inside. The absorbent cotton 32 can also be replaced promptly by removing the collection tray 3.

[0040] Specifically, the movement of motor 53 causes the curtain of roller shutter 52 to move up and down. During drying and disinfection, the curtain is lowered to its lowest point and fixed by magnetic strip 55, allowing the warm air output by heater 6 to be more fully reflected inside the drying chamber 1, resulting in a higher temperature inside the drying chamber 1, increasing drying efficiency, reducing leakage of ultraviolet germicidal lamp 4, and avoiding ultraviolet radiation to staff. The curtain also keeps the device in a semi-sealed state, reducing the entry of external substances and further preventing the disinfected slippers from being contaminated.

[0044] This utility model discloses a shoe drying device for operating rooms. It dries slippers, reducing the possibility of external contamination and avoiding the accidental touching or contamination of slippers by external substances, which is a problem with traditional shoe racks. This makes slippers safer inside the device and allows for continuous sterilization, preventing bacterial growth and providing a safer place to store slippers, thus reducing the possibility of secondary contamination.
